WebbReservoir hydropower plants account for half of net hydropower additions through 2030 in our forecast. Pumped storage hydropower plants represent 30% of net hydropower additions through 2030 in our forecast. Run-of-river hydropower remains the smallest growth segment because it includes many small-scale projects below 10 MW. Webb10 jan. 2024 · The upper power limit for small hydropower plants varies depending on the country: the UK < 5 MW, France <8 MW, the USA <30 MW, Canada <50 MW [52].
